Immunization, measles in Nicaragua
Nicaragua: Immunization, measles was 85.0% in 2023. ▲ Rising
Immunization, measles in Nicaragua, 1980–2023
Source: World Health Organization (WHO). Measured in % of children ages 12-23 months.
Analysis
In 2023, immunization, measles in Nicaragua stood at 85.0%.
The figure is down 8.6% on the previous year and down 14.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, immunization, measles in Nicaragua peaked at 99.0% in 2001 and was at its lowest, 15.0%, in 1980.
Nicaragua ranks 125th of 193 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 44 years of available data.

About this data
Child immunization, measles, measures the percentage of children ages 12-23 months who received the measles vaccination before 12 months or at any time before the survey. A child is considered adequately immunized against measles after receiving one dose of vaccine.
